FORT WORTH, Texas, March 4 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- American Eagle reported a February load factor of 69.0 percent -- down 0.4 points compared to the same period last year. Traffic decreased 2.4 percent year over year as capacity decreased 1.9 percent.
American Eagle boarded 1.5 million passengers in February.

AMERICAN EAGLE
COMPARATIVE PRELIMINARY TRAFFIC SUMMARY
FEBRUARY
2008 2007 CHANGE
PASSENGER MILES (000)
SYSTEM 607,697 622,853 (2.4)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 564,090 581,796 (3.0)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 43,607 41,056 6.2
SEAT MILES (000)
SYSTEM 880,608 897,635 (1.9)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 804,443 829,955 (3.1)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 76,165 67,680 12.5
LOAD FACTOR
SYSTEM 69.0 69.4 (0.4) pts
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 70.1 70.1 -
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 57.3 60.7 (3.4)
PASSENGERS BOARDED
SYSTEM 1,465,947 1,492,881 (1.8)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 1,262,195 1,289,107 (2.1)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 203,752 203,774 (0.0)
YEAR-TO-DATE
2008 2007 CHANGE
PASSENGER MILES (000)
SYSTEM 1,243,138 1,284,490 (3.2)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 1,152,095 1,198,482 (3.9)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 91,043 86,007 5.9
SEAT MILES (000)
SYSTEM 1,853,506 1,924,544 (3.7)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 1,692,919 1,778,090 (4.8)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 160,587 146,455 9.6
LOAD FACTOR
SYSTEM 67.1 66.7 0.4 pts
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 68.1 67.4 0.7
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 56.7 58.7 (2.0)
PASSENGERS BOARDED
SYSTEM 2,987,519 3,072,320 (2.8)%
AMERICAN EAGLE AIRLINES 2,566,726 2,653,868 (3.3)
EXECUTIVE AIRLINES 420,793 418,452 0.6
